The Purrfect Passage: Why Hiring a Professional Cat Access Door Installer is a Smart Move
For cat lovers, supplying their feline companions with flexibility and independence is frequently a top priority. Cat access doors, likewise referred to as cat flaps or pet doors, provide a wonderful solution, permitting felines to come and go as they please, venturing into the outdoors or retreating inside your home for security and comfort. While the idea appears uncomplicated, the installation of a cat access door is not constantly a basic DIY project. This is where the know-how of a professional cat access door installer ends up being invaluable.
Working with a professional installer to fit your cat door offers a wide range of advantages, guaranteeing not just a smooth and effective installation but likewise the durability and efficiency of the door itself. This post looks into why selecting a professional installer is a smart decision for any cat owner wanting to supply their furry pal with practical and protected access.

What Does a Cat Access Door Installer Actually Do?
The process of installing a cat door by a professional is more than simply cutting a hole and placing a flap. It's a thorough service created to ensure ideal performance and visual integration.
Here's a common breakdown of what a cat door installer will do:
- Consultation and Assessment: The process often starts with an assessment. The installer will discuss your requirements, evaluate your existing doors or walls, and identify the very best location and type of cat door for your home and your cat. They will think about aspects like door product, density, and the presence of any circuitry or plumbing that might be impacted.
- Door Selection Guidance: If you have not already chosen a cat door, the installer can provide guidance on choosing the best type. They can encourage on functions like flap type (requirement, magnetic, microchip), size, and product, guaranteeing it matches your cat's size and your security preferences. They may even offer a variety of doors for you to select from.
- Exact Measurement and Marking: Accurate measurements are important for a successful installation. The installer will carefully determine the door or wall and mark the accurate place for the cat door opening, taking into account the manufacturer's specs and guaranteeing it is at the proper height for your cat.
- Cutting and Installation: Using customized tools, the installer will thoroughly cut the opening in your chosen place. Whether it's a wooden door, glass panel, or wall, they will employ the appropriate techniques to ensure a tidy and precise cut. They will then set up the cat door frame and secure cat flap installation it strongly in location.
- Sealing and Weatherproofing: An essential step is guaranteeing the cat door is effectively sealed and weatherproofed. The installer will utilize appropriate sealants to avoid drafts, water ingress, and insect entry around the door frame, keeping the energy effectiveness and comfort of your home.
- Clean-up and Demonstration: Once the installation is total, a professional installer will clean up the work location, removing any debris and ensuring your home is left tidy. They will also demonstrate the performance of the cat door, describing any features and offering recommendations on how to train your cat to use it, if needed.
Kinds Of Cat Access Doors and Installation Locations:
Professional installers excel in dealing with a variety of cat door types and installation locations. This versatility is another crucial benefit of employing an expert.
Here are some typical kinds of cat doors and places installers can work with:

Types of Cat Doors:
- Standard Flap Doors: These are simple, economical doors with a versatile flap that the cat presses through.
- Magnetic Cat Doors: These doors need the same-day cat flap installation to wear a magnetic collar, preventing undesirable animals from going into.
- Microchip Cat Doors: These are the most secure and sophisticated choices, reading your cat's microchip to enable entry just to your pet, keeping out roaming animals and preserving home security.
- Tunnel Cat Doors: Designed for thicker walls or doors, these doors use a tunnel extension to bridge the space.
Installation Locations/Materials:
- Wooden Doors: The most typical installation area. Installers are experienced in cutting and fitting doors into various types of wood doors, consisting of solid core and hollow core.
- Glass Doors and Windows: Installing cat doors in glass requires specialized abilities and tools. Professionals can safely cut circular or rectangular holes in glass panels, guaranteeing structural stability and a clean finish.
- Walls: For more discreet access, cat doors can be installed in walls, typically leading to basements or garages. This needs competence in wall construction and framing.
- Patio Doors and Sliding Doors: Installers can fit cat doors into existing patio doors or sliding glass doors, often by replacing a glass panel with one pre-cut for a pet door Installation door.
- Screen Doors: Mesh screen doors can likewise accommodate cat doors, allowing ventilation while offering pet access.

Cost Considerations for Professional Installation:
The cost of professional cat door installation can differ depending upon numerous aspects:
- Type of Cat Door: More sophisticated doors like microchip designs might have a slightly greater installation cost due to their intricacy.
- Installation Location and Material: Installing in glass or walls is generally more complicated and might cost more than setting up in a standard wooden door.
- Complexity of the Job: If adjustments to the door frame or surrounding structure are needed, this can increase the general cost.
- Installer's Rates and Location: Installer rates can differ depending on their experience, place, and local market costs.
It's always best to get a comprehensive quote from the installer before continuing, laying out all costs included.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s) about Cat Access Door Installation:
- DIY vs. Professional Installation: Which is better? For simple replacements in standard wooden doors, DIY may be feasible for knowledgeable house owners. However, for complicated setups, glass, walls, or for those looking for peace of mind and ensured quality, professional installation is highly advised.
- How long does a professional cat door installation take? Most standard setups can be completed within a couple of hours. More complicated installations in glass or walls might take longer.
- What is the typical cost of professional cat door installation? Expenses differ commonly depending on the aspects pointed out above, but anticipate to pay anywhere from ₤ 150 to ₤ 500 or more, including the door and installation, depending upon complexity. Get quotes for accurate pricing.
- Can installers fit small cat flap installation doors into glass doors? Yes, numerous professional installers concentrate on glass door setups, utilizing specialized tools and strategies to guarantee a safe and clean installation.
- Do professional installations come with a warranty? Reliable installers generally provide service warranties on their craftsmanship. Ask about service warranty information before working with.
